Ben Fowler (Kent, ENG) finished 0-3 in the 28-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Fowler lost 6-1 to Marc Pfister (Adelboden, SUI), droppimg another game, 10-4 to Joel Retornaz (Trentino, ITA). Fowler lost 8-3 to Sebastian Wunderer (Kitzbuhel, AUT) in their final qualifying round match.
. For week 31 of the event schedule, Fowler did not improve upon their best events, dropping from 635th to 636th place overall on the World Ranking Standings with 0.274 total points. Fowler ranks 681st over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 0.000 points earned so far this season.
